1. 核心框架变化
ActFramework 1.8.23 发布, 带来的变化有:
#1143 CLI 列表显示 - 交替反显, 更加便于阅读数据:
#1142 增加 @Label 注解, Excel 和 CSV 输出的时候显示更加友好的名字:
CLI 列表的变化:
注意, JSON 数据输出不会收到 @Label 注解影响, 主要考虑是 JSON 为系统服务的, 而 Label 则是为人读取的
#1141 修复 Java Validation - Email Handler 的错误 - 无法正确识别 xxx@yyy.studio 这样的邮件
现在框架从 http://data.iana.org/TLD/tlds-alpha-by-domain.txt 定期刷新顶级域名后缀列表, 更加准确判断邮件地址是否有效
#1138 `@Every` 注解和 `@OnAppStart` 注解一起使用时失效的问题
2. Act Starters 变化
与此同时 act-starter-parent 更新到了 1.8.23.2 版本, 请已经使用 parent 的同学更新你们的 pom.xml 文件:
<parent>
<groupId>org.actframework</groupId>
<artifactId>act-starter-parent</artifactId>
<version>1.8.23.2</version>
</parent>
3. 其他组件变化
同时更新的有
- act-sql-common-1.4.6 - 解决了 HikariCP 错误配置问题
- act-beetl-1.5.2 - 紧追 beetl 至3.0.3.RELEASE
- act-beetlsql-1.5.10 - 紧追 beetlsql 至 2.12.4.RELEASE
- act-morphia-1.7.2 - 强烈优化数据聚合 API, 请移步至这里围观新的数据聚合方式
原文
https://www.oschina.net/news/107527/actframework-1-8-23